Pour it and you get a clear ruby red. The nose is friendly straight away, soft plums and blackberry with a quiet whisper of vanilla underneath. First sip is smooth and round with a gentle sweetness, then a little freshness cuts across the fruit so it never turns sticky or heavy. The tannins (that grippy, drying thing big reds do) are basically asleep here, so it slides down easy. Light, fruity, sweet but balanced. A red for people who don't usually do reds.

Where it's from
Montmeyrac comes from France, made by Les Grands Chais de France, a family wine house started back in 1979 by Joseph Helfrich. They grew from a small operation into one of France's biggest exporters, and Montmeyrac is their easygoing, everyday range. Think bright, young, fruit-forward wines built for the dinner table and the picnic blanket, not the dusty cellar. This red is mostly Tempranillo with a splash of Grenache, the same grapes that give it that ripe, juicy character.

- How do I serve it?
Lightly chilled, around 12 to 14°C. Pop it in the fridge for 30 to 40 minutes, pour into any wine glass, and you're sorted.
